Performance
The performance gap is the most significant differentiator. The Umidigi G2’s MediaTek Helio A22, a quad-core processor built on a 12nm process, is designed for basic tasks. The Xiaomi Redmi Note 13R’s Qualcomm Snapdragon 4+ Gen 2, an octa-core processor fabricated on a more efficient 4nm node, represents a substantial leap forward. The Cortex-A78 cores in the Snapdragon 4+ Gen 2 provide significantly more processing power than the Cortex-A53 cores in the Helio A22, resulting in faster app loading times, smoother multitasking, and a more responsive user interface. The 4nm process also translates to better thermal management, reducing the likelihood of throttling during sustained workloads. This benefits users who play mobile games or use demanding applications.

Frequently Asked Questions
❓ Will the Redmi Note 13R be able to run popular games like PUBG Mobile or Call of Duty?
The Snapdragon 4+ Gen 2 is capable of running PUBG Mobile and Call of Duty, but you’ll likely need to lower the graphics settings to medium or low to achieve a smooth frame rate. The Umidigi G2’s Helio A22 will struggle significantly with these titles, offering a poor gaming experience.
❓ How much faster is the charging on the Redmi Note 13R compared to the Umidigi G2?
The Redmi Note 13R’s 33W charging is dramatically faster. While exact 0-100% times are unavailable, expect the Redmi Note 13R to fully charge in around 60-90 minutes, whereas the Umidigi G2’s 10W charging could take over 3 hours.
❓ Is the difference in performance between the two chipsets noticeable in everyday tasks like browsing and social media?
Yes, the difference is very noticeable. The Redmi Note 13R’s Snapdragon 4+ Gen 2 will provide a much smoother and more responsive experience when browsing the web, scrolling through social media feeds, and opening apps. The Umidigi G2’s Helio A22 will exhibit noticeable lag and slowdowns.
